Fundraising

​Sunnyside Elementary and SFUSD work hard to provide the best education possible for our children. Unfortunately public school budgets are limited and do not provide the wide array of programs, resources and additional school staff our children need to thrive.


The Sunnyside Elementary PTA helps bridge this gap in funding through community fundraisers, direct donations, company matching, and grants in order to provide these essential programs and staff. We are kicking off our biggest fundraiser of the year — the 2022-23 Annual Fund — with a goal of $160,000 to be raised. This is 75% of our entire PTA fundraising goal so we need your help to reach that goal by November 5. We can reach our Annual Fund goal if each family donates $480 per student. Funding Drives

Annual Fund

​This is our biggest fundraiser of the year and contributes over 75% of the PTA budget. Every gift matters and all donations are fully tax-deductible. Our Annual Fund goal for the 2021–2022 school year is to raise $150,000 during the month of October.

Events

Fall (or Spring) Fest: a carnival-style celebration with food, games and raffle.
Bid Bash: a lively, adults-only evening event with food, wine, and both live and silent auctions. See the Events page for a gallery.

Corporate Matching

​Many employers will match your donation to the PTA. Check with your company’s HR department to see if they have a matching gifts program. Please email ​fundraising@sunnysidesf.org for assistance or questions.

Count-Me-Ins

​Count-Me-Ins (CMIs) are teacher- or parent-hosted events to build community and raise money for Sunnyside PTA. It’s a great way to get to know other families while helping raise funds.
